Sec. 626. Nuclear energy enabling technologies program

Subtitle E of title IX of the Energy Policy Act of 2005 ( 42 U.S.C. 16271 et seq. ) is amended by adding at the end the following new section: The Secretary shall conduct a program to support the integration of activities undertaken through the reactor concepts research, development, demonstration, and commercial application program under section 952(c) and the fuel cycle research and development program under section 953, and support crosscutting nuclear energy concepts. Activities commenced under this section shall be concentrated on broadly applicable research and development focus areas.
Activities conducted under this section may include research involving— advanced reactor materials; advanced radiation mitigation methods; advanced proliferation and security risk assessment methods; advanced sensors and instrumentation; high performance computation modeling, including multiphysics, multidimensional modeling simulation for nuclear energy systems, and continued development of advanced modeling simulation capabilities through national laboratory, industry, and university partnerships for operations and safety performance improvements of light water reactors for currently deployed and near-term reactors and advanced reactors and for the development of small modular reactors; and any crosscutting technology or transformative concept aimed at establishing substantial and revolutionary enhancements in the performance of future nuclear energy systems that the Secretary considers relevant and appropriate to the purpose of this section.
The Secretary shall submit, as part of the annual budget submission of the Department, a report on the activities of the program conducted under this section, which shall include a brief evaluation of each activity’s progress. . The table of contents of the Energy Policy Act of 2005 is amended by adding at the end of the items for subtitle E of title IX the following new item: Sec. 958. Nuclear energy enabling technologies. .
